As per Ballyhoura, try this website: http://visitballyhoura.com/

I live in Cork city and been biking there few times but never stayed overnight.
Mitchelstown might be a good spot as it's not too far away from the biking centre. But it's a small enought town, nightlife might be poor. If you're looking for a city nearby try Limerick or Cork.
